"We were solid and determined throughout the match," S. Hornby remarked after another strong performance for Walsall in goal. His crucial saves have kept the Saddlers in contention this season in England's League Two. The stakes are high this year, and Hornby's performances have been pivotal in securing points for the team.

As the season progresses, the pressure on Hornby has intensified. The 25-year-old has produced several standout moments, notably a crucial penalty save last month that kept Walsall in the hunt against tough opponents. The rain-soaked pitch at the Banks's Stadium often tests players, but Hornby's calm demeanor under pressure has made him a fan favorite.

His ability to read the game is widely praised. Hornby doesn't just stop shots; he commands his area, organizing the defense effectively. Last weekend's clash against Carlisle United showcased this talent, as he not only saved multiple chances but also contributed to the team's momentum with quick distributions.

As Walsall looks to climb the table, fans will continue to look to Hornby as a key player in their aspirations for promotion. His journey from youth prospect to first-team regular reflects his dedication to the game. Will he retain this form and inspire Walsall to greater heights? Only time will tell.
